Foundation Restoration in Tampa, FL
Foundation restoration services involve repairing and stabilizing the structural base of a property to address issues such as cracks, settling, or shifting. These projects typically include techniques like foundation underpinning, piering, and sealing to prevent further damage and ensure the stability of the building. Homeowners often request foundation restoration when noticing signs such as uneven floors, cracked walls, or gaps around windows and doors, which can indicate underlying problems that need professional attention.
Before requesting foundation restoration, property owners should understand the extent of the damage and the potential causes, such as soil movement or moisture issues. It is also helpful to be aware of the different repair methods available and how they may impact the property’s long-term stability. Proper assessment and planning are essential to determine the most appropriate solution for maintaining the safety and value of the home.

Common Foundation Restoration Jobs
Foundation Repair - stabilizes and strengthens the foundation to prevent further settling or cracking.
Foundation Leveling - corrects uneven floors and foundation shifts for a safer, more stable structure.
Pier and Beam Repair - addresses issues with support piers and beams to improve home stability.
Crack Injection - seals foundation cracks to prevent water intrusion and further damage.
Soil Stabilization - improves soil conditions beneath the foundation to reduce movement and settling.
Basement Foundation Repair - restores the integrity of basement walls and floors to prevent leaks and structural issues.
Foundation Restoration Questions
What are signs of foundation issues in a home? Common signs include c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, and doors or windows that don’t close properly.
What types of foundation restoration services are available? Services include underpinning, piering, slab stabilization, and crack repair to restore stability and prevent further damage.
How can foundation problems affect property value? Unaddressed foundation issues can decrease property value and make homes less attractive to potential buyers.
What should property owners consider before starting foundation repair? It’s important to have a professional assessment to determine the extent of damage and the most suitable repair method.
